The aim of this work was to evaluate the microbial activity of the surface sediments (0-10 cm) of the Chacopata-Bocaripo lagoon axis (Ch-BLA) through microbiological parameters: microbial biomass (Cmic) dehydrogenase activity (DHS), fluorescein diacetate hydrolysis (HFDA), arginine ammonification (AA) and biochemical parameters: phosphatase (PHa) and urease (URa) activity. They were determined during transition (July 2010) and upwelling (March 2011) periods. Total organic carbon (TOC) did not vary significantly (p⩾0.05) between climatic periods. All the parameters studied were higher in upwelling season: Cmic (191.79 mg Cmic kg(-1)), DHS (228.70 µg TFF g(-1) 24 h(-1)), HFDA (204.09 µg fluorescein g(-1) 24 h(-1)), AA (13.09 µg NH4-N g(-1) h(-1)), PHa (132.31 µg pNF g(-1) h(-1)), URa (12.90 µg NH4-N g(-1) h(-1)). They appear to be controlled by the availability and quality of nutrients in each climatic period, and were useful tools for evaluating changes in microbial activity in marine sediments.

Perna viridis was used as biomonitor to assess heavy metal levels in the Chacopata-Bocaripo lagoon axis, Venezuela, during rain and drought seasons. The mussels were weighed and measured. The metal concentrations were determined by atomic absorption spectrophotometry. For rain period, the order of bioavailability was: Cu>Ni>Mn>Co>Cd>Pb, and for drought: Cu>Mn>Ni>Co>Pb>Cd. The concentrations of Ni, Co, Cd and Pb showed significant differences (P<0.05) in both periods. There was higher metal accumulation during drought season, possibly related to upwelling, since it produces an increase in primary productivity, which translates more food into organisms, making metals bioavailable for mussels. Only Cu and Mn showed significant relationships between the size and metal concentration, during drought period, it may be because of the organisms need for these essential metals in different physiological processes.

The aim of this work was to determine the frequency of different reproductive phases and to induce the germination of spores from tetrasporic and cystocarpic Gracilariopsis tenuifrons from Chacopata and La Peña, Venezuela, under controlled laboratory conditions (temperature 22 +/- 1 degree C, 12L:12D photoperiod, salinity of 36 +/-1 PSU and irradiance of 269 microE m(-2) s(-1)). Tetrasporic individuals dominated numerically over gametophitic individuals. The proportion of vegetative algae was very low. Only cystocarpic algae were collected and the spermatangia were absent. Sporulation, germination and formation of algae suggest that they present a Polysiphonia-type life cycle. Algae with reproductive structures were not obtained in the laboratory,

The marine algal flora from the eastern coast of Mochima National Park, Sucre, Venezuela was studied with a total of 51 taxa identified, including eight new additions of red algae which are Erythrotrichia carnea (Dillwyn) J. Agardh, Sahlingia subintegra (Rosenvinge) Kornmann, Liagora ceranoides Lamouroux, Asparagopsis taxiformis (Delile) Trevisan, Dasya corymbifera J. Agardh, Chondria dasyphylla (Woodward) C. Agardh, Herposiphonia secunda f. tenella (C. Agardh) M.J. Wynne and Polysiphonia subtilissima Montagne. Morphological and anatomical aspects of the specimens are described and illustrated.
